Green dragon is a leafy green vegetable that is often used in Chinese cuisine. It is also known as “vegetable amaranth” or “Chinese spinach”.

Details

Nutrition

Green dragon is a healthy and nutritious vegetable that is low in calories and carbs. It is a good source of vitamins A, C, and K, as well as calcium, iron, and magnesium. Green dragon is also a good source of antioxidants, which can help protect cells from damage.

Taste and Texture

Green dragon has a slightly bitter taste and a crunchy texture. It is often used in salads, soups, stir-fries, and curries.

How to Use

Green dragon is best eaten fresh. It can be stored in the refrigerator for up to a week.

To use green dragon, wash the leaves and trim off the stems. You can then add it to salads, soups, stir-fries, or curries.

When to Use

Green dragon is best used in the spring and summer months. It can be found in most grocery stores and farmers markets.

Where to Find

Green dragon can be found in most grocery stores and farmers markets. It is often sold in the produce section.
